About this pack
Year 2 is the year of the spelling rule: soft c, silent letters, -le endings, the possessive apostrophe and a small crowd of homophones, all from the national curriculum, alongside the 64 common exception words that cannot be sounded out. This pack takes them one at a time. Every rule has its own page, with a short explanation at the top, a main task in the middle and a challenge box at the bottom for children who want more.
The 64 exception words get the look, cover, write, check routine most classes already use, and a tracker so you can see which words are secure rather than spelt right once. Dictation, two mixed reviews and a 20-point assessment tie everything together, and the answer key means nobody has to guess. The pages have big writing lines with a dotted midline, print clearly in black and white, and work as one page a session at home or as morning work, homework or intervention at school.

Questions
Is it in line with the national curriculum?
Yes. It follows English Appendix 1 for Year 2, which is the spelling content used in schools in England.
Will it prepare my child for SATs?
KS1 SATs have been optional since the 2023 to 2024 school year. The pack supports weekly spelling tests and the optional tests if your school uses them.
Is it suitable for Year 3 catch-up or a confident Year 1?
Yes. The words and rules are the same whenever a child meets them, and the pupil pages do not mention a year group.
How do I use the tracker?
Tick each exception word when your child spells it correctly from memory, tick again on a later day, and only then write the date.
